I am not really sure that I needed another upgrade, but I went for it! 
Added this round: 

Another Side mount CPU rack on the right hand side. This one is holding a new high end PC that matches the one on the left.  I left the cabling long enough on this one to reach to a seconday desk for 2player Head to head FPS style games. 

A 24" monitor in the center. The 20" I was using was getting a bit cramped and lets face it, I am not getting any younger and my eyesight none the better. I suspect I am getting very close to the weight capacity of my desk.

Tucked behind the monitors I added the Phillips amBX lighting system. Cause mood lighting is cool.

In the center position of CPU's I've repurposed one of the old PC's to a Windows Home Server, added tons of Storage capacity, moved all my media files and am running automated backups and restore services for the other computers.

4 out of the 6 Gaming PC's are now running Windows Vista 64bit, thanks to a subscription to TechNET plus.
